Mark Henry Isn’t A Big Fan Of The ‘Bloodline Rules’ Stipulation For WrestleMania 40 Match

Cody Rhodes could have his hands full with Roman Reigns at WrestleMania 40 if he and Seth Rollins can’t beat The Rock and the Tribal Chief on Night One of the pay-per-view event. As many of you know by now, if Rollins and Rhodes lose at WrestleMania (Night One), Rhodes’ match with Roman Reigns on Night Two will be contested under “Bloodline Rules” stipulations.

Speaking on a recent edition of the “Busted Open Radio” podcast, Mark Henry commented on the “high stakes” stipulation. He said,

“Not only is it high stakes, [WWE] basically have set up a way now that the Bloodline can do whatever they want. I mean, don’t you want fair? Everybody should be working towards fair, one-on-one, mano a mano, the title of ‘The Tribal Chief’ and ‘The Head of The Table, and most of all, Universal Champion rolled into one. And I feel like if you allow all of this interference, it takes away from that.”

He continued, “But that’s kind of what they’re gearing toward. I feel like the focus should be more on the honor of the big event rather than, what can we get away with?”
